Riga's Beloved Yiddish Theater

Watch now:

Yakob Basner, Yiddish teacher and Holocaust survivor, recalls the thriving Yiddish theater scene in Riga before the war, and how he used to go to show with his neighbor who worked as a stagehand.

This is an excerpt from an oral history with Yakob Basner.

This excerpt is in Yiddish.

Yakob Basner was born in 1927. Yakob died in 2021.
